Smart Manufacturing Connectivity for Brown-field Sensors Testbed
Another finding by the Testbed team was the discovery that the amount of work put into developing a testbed is similar to that required when setting up an application for a governmentally funded research project . That is why it could make sense for IIC members to combine future research projects with testbeds . The practical aspect of a research endeavor could be implemented through a testbed , but it would largely depend from case-to-case whether such an approach would be practical or not .
To reduce the amount of work , proper planning in the testbed preparation phase is required . The schedule must be near exact and each testbed team member must understand each partner company ’ s technologies . IT and OT people have different mindsets , terminologies and expectations towards other parties that are involved in a testbed . Good team preparation helps overcome typical struggles in the initial phase of a testbed to optimize collaboration .
By nature , the Testbed focuses on technical aspects . A usage scenario was defined and implemented for demonstration and validation purposes only . However , the Testbed ’ s objectives and message could have been delivered even better through the inclusion of multiple business-relevant usage scenarios .
The intention is to roll the Testbed solution out to TE factories as an operations development project involving the Y- Gateway . This device is ready to be industrialized and prepared to sell . However , a demand for a considerable number of devices by TE ’ s customers is required to define the final portfolio , variants , etc .
CONCLUSION
The Testbed provides a high volume of sensor data from brown-field manufacturing installations to enterprise IT systems in near real-time . The Testbed team attributes its remarkable success to good and early team preparation , respect across the OT / IT divide , valuable industry-leading participants , input from many IIC experts and IIC industry resources such as the IIRA , IICF and IISF . Their successes are influencing industry standards and Testbed participants are exploring paths to deployment and consumer demand in multiple real industry implementations .
